About Junqing Wu
Junqing Wu is a scholar working on Molecular Biology, Plant Science, Epidemiology, Physiology and Oncology, having authored 24 papers that have together received 408 indexed citations. Recurring topics across this work include Plant Reproductive Biology (7 papers), Plant Molecular Biology Research (7 papers), Plant Gene Expression Analysis (5 papers), Calcium signaling and nucleotide metabolism (3 papers), Autophagy in Disease and Therapy (3 papers), Phytochemicals and Antioxidant Activities (2 papers), Acute Lymphoblastic Leukemia research (2 papers) and Plant Physiology and Cultivation Studies (1 paper). The work is most often cited by research in Biochemistry (38 citations), Geriatrics and Gerontology (14 citations), Molecular Biology (219 citations), Plant Science (120 citations) and Emergency Medicine (24 citations). Junqing Wu has collaborated with scholars based in China, Japan and United States. Frequent co-authors include Yixiang Han, Shenghui Zhang, Lugang Zhang, Ru Li, Qiong He, Songfu Jiang, Gang Hu, Kang Yu, Shuang Wu and Yuqing Dong. Their work appears in journals such as New Phytologist, Journal of Cellular and Molecular Medicine, Horticulture Research, Frontiers in Plant Science and Horticultural Plant Journal.
